Since I was a small kid, I've known deeply that I will grow up into a bald guy, and I've never dreamed that I will keep my hair till 25 years old. Although not all my uncles from both sides are bald, it is easy to predict that I will lose hair, as my father lost hair at the age of 22.
I was born with very thick hair and successfully kept it until last year, though my eating habits are very bad. So, Sept-2016 to Feb-2017 was not easy for me at all, I had a full-time stressful job from 9 am to 9 pm, which was exhausting mentally and physically and I believe it triggered anxiety and accordingly hair loss.
on 20th Aug 2017, I've decided that I should keep my hair until my wedding, which most likely will be the summer of next year. I did my small homework on the Internet, called my pharmacist doctor and here I start taking 1 mg Propecia, Rogaine and Priorin.
The first 3 months I shaded hair like I've never done in my life, to the point where my co-workers starting to complain about my hair falling at their desk, the thing that pushed me to trim my hair at 3. However, I kept my faith in medicine.
Months 4 and 5, I reaped the result. No more shading or hair loss. I could feel it thicker and even people start to notice that, but unfortunately my hair loss start hitting again in the 6th month, which I really couldn't explain. Additionally, I can feel my hair is much thinner like the previous two months.
I will appreciate your recommendation here, is it normal or it is not working with me anymore?
